Exposure database
Every barangay against every hazard
The matrix the rest of the assessment is built onThe share of each barangay susceptible to each hazard at moderate level or above, with the DHSUD exposure score that share earns.
| Barangay | Area (ha) | Flood | Rain-induced Landslide | Liquefaction |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Bautista | 174.7 | not mapped | 98.4% 4 | 9.1% 1 |
| Gana | 173.2 | 41.3% 4 | 19.9% 2 | 74.1% 4 |
| Juan Cartas | 183.0 | 11.5% 2 | 87.7% 4 | not mapped |
| Las-ud | 39.6 | 86.7% 4 | 0.0% 1 | 100.0% 4 |
| Liquicia | 699.4 | 16.3% 2 | 76.3% 4 | 8.5% 1 |
| Poblacion Norte | 62.2 | 0.1% 1 | 79.1% 4 | 27.2% 3 |
| Poblacion Sur | 19.1 | 28.1% 3 | 32.3% 3 | 63.9% 4 |
| San Carlos | 140.2 | 53.7% 4 | 2.3% 1 | 96.4% 4 |
| San Cornelio | 457.0 | 19.5% 2 | 81.0% 4 | not mapped |
| San Fermin | 1,098.8 | 4.7% 1 | 92.2% 4 | not mapped |
| San Gregorio | 286.7 | 31.1% 3 | 64.8% 4 | not mapped |
| San Jose | 695.5 | 24.1% 3 | 75.3% 4 | 14.6% 2 |
| Santiago Norte | 15.9 | 78.2% 4 | not mapped | 90.4% 4 |
| Santiago Sur | 139.2 | 90.3% 4 | 0.0% 1 | 99.0% 4 |
| Sobredillo | 354.0 | 15.2% 2 | 81.4% 4 | 0.0% 1 |
| Urayong | 120.0 | 9.9% 1 | 85.6% 4 | 11.2% 2 |
| Wenceslao | 32.9 | 76.9% 4 | 0.0% 1 | 99.8% 4 |
“not mapped” is not zero. It means the agency published no polygon of that hazard intersecting the barangay. Whether that means the barangay is safe or merely unmapped is a question for the planner, and this report will not answer it by assumption.
